No insurance? Call the Kenosha County Behavioral Health Resource Center at (262) 764-8555 to ask about county funding and free program options.

The need is real. According to local health data, 32% of Kenosha County residents named drug and alcohol use as one of their top three health concerns. Opioid-related deaths in the county reached 36 per 100,000 people per year — a number that reflects how urgently accessible treatment is needed.

Outpatient care is one of the most common and effective ways to receive low-cost treatment. It allows you to maintain your job and stay with your family while attending structured therapy sessions. Many of these programs utilize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T), which combines FDA-approved medications like methadone or buprenorphine with behavioral counseling. This “whole-patient” approach is widely considered the gold standard for opioid addiction recovery.

To ensure you are receiving high-quality care, we always recommend looking for facilities with CARF (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facilities) accreditation or Joint Commission standards. These seals of approval mean the center meets rigorous national safety and treatment quality requirements. The effectiveness of these programs is backed by data. Research shows that 40% to 60% of individuals who complete a rehab program remain drug-free or significantly reduce their substance use. Levels of Care: From Detox to Outpatient Services

Recovery isn’t a one-size-fits-all process. Depending on the severity of the addiction, different levels of care are necessary:

  1. Medical Detox: Often the first step, providing 24/7 medical supervision to manage withdrawal symptoms safely.
  2. Residential Care: These are typically 30-60 day programs where you live at the facility. While often more expensive, many low-cost options exist through state-funded beds.
  3. Partial Hospitalization (PHP): A high level of care where you spend the day at the center but return home at night.
  4.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P): These offer several hours of therapy per week, allowing for a balance between treatment and daily life.

Understanding how to pay for treatment is often the biggest hurdle. The good news is that federal law requires most insurance plans to cover addiction treatment just like any other medical condition.

Wisconsin Medicaid (BadgerCare Plus) is a primary lifeline for low-income residents in Kenosha, covering a wide range of services from detox to MAT. Additionally, SAMHSA (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ration) provides block grants to the state, which are then distributed to local clinics to fund treatment for those without insurance.

Kenosha County Treatment Court and Crisis Services

For those whose addiction has led to legal trouble, the Kenosha County Treatment Court offers a life-changing alternative to incarceration. This 60-week phased program provides intensive legal supervision combined with holistic recovery services. It aims to reduce recidivism by treating the root cause of the behavior rather than just punishing it.

If you are in immediate trouble, please don’t wait. The 988 Suicide & Crisis Lifeline is available 24/7. Locally, you can call the Kenosha Crisis Line at 262-657-7188 for immediate walk-in guidance or phone support. Local Impact and Opioid Crisis Statistics

The numbers in Kenosha County tell a sobering story. We see an average of 3 opioid-related ambulance runs per week, totaling over 610 runs between 2019 and 2022. There are 57 opioid-related emergency department visits per 100,000 residents annually.

These aren’t just stats; they are our neighbors. This is why we advocate so strongly for anti-stigma campaigns. When we stop viewing addiction as a moral failure and start seeing it as a treatable health condition, more people feel safe reaching out for help.

Frequently Asked Questions about Low-Cost Rehab in Kenosha

What if I do not have any health insurance?

You still have options! Contact the Kenosha County Behavioral Health Resource Center. They specialize in connecting residents to county funding and state-financed health plans. Many local non-profits also use a sliding fee scale, meaning your cost could be $0 depending on your income.

Are there free programs for pregnant women in Kenosha?

Yes. Pregnant women are often given priority for state-funded treatment. Specialized MAT programs in the area focus on improved birth outcomes and provide comprehensive case management and prenatal support, often fully covered by Medicaid.

How do I find free peer support groups?

Kenosha has a thriving community of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) and Narcotics Anonymous (NA) meetings, which are always free to attend. Additionally, SMART Recovery offers an evidence-based alternative to the 12-step model. Wisconsin also supports 11 peer-run centers that operate under “sanctuary agreements,” providing a safe space for recovery support.
